> > This indeed was a Hoax!  No Virus can wipe the hard disk just by reading
> > an e-mail message.  BUT, this message below told of an attachment that if
> > run would cause dammage!
> 
> This is not true on Unix!  Many Unix mailers and pagers will send
> escape codes to the tty.  The good ones will not, but many of
> the old ones will.  This will allow a mail message to control the
> terminal.  Many terminals has escape codes to send text back to
> the host.  QED the mail message can do anything the user has privs
> to do.
